All payment retries through the Lumivault gateway must include an idempotency key. Generate one per logical charge, not per attempt; reuse it on every retry so Lumivault dedupes server-side. Keys expire after 24 hours. Never reuse a key across distinct charges — you'll get a 409. For sandbox testing against the Tollbridge mock service, authenticate using the key below.

service key, yadug-bajog: zpat3_pou

**Vendor note: Inkmill markdown pipeline**

Rendering for Parchway docs is outsourced to Inkmill under an annual contract, renewing each March. They handle sanitization and PDF export; we own the upload queue. SLA: 4-hour response on rendering failures. Escalate only after two failed retries. Their support desk is reachable at the address below.

billing contact of hahaf-baguf = zorael.tammir.jorius@sivrelhq.internal

Onboarding note: the Querydeck planner regression (v41) can resurface under heavy join fanout. Symptoms: plan times over 2s, nested-loop picks on large relations. Mitigation: pin the v40 planner via the Flagstone toggle. Confirm with `qd explain --pinned`. To flip the toggle from the CLI, authenticate with the key below.

service key, fawip-bajef: kto11_Qt5wZK9vdNC

### Changelog — 2024-W18: Key Rotation (Coldstart Service)

Rotated the deploy signing key for the Briarhalt serverless handlers after the quarterly audit flagged the old key's age. Cold-start latency was re-benchmarked post-rotation; no regression observed (p95 held at 412ms). All handler bundles were re-signed and redeployed. The new key, effective immediately, is:

release key, kajep-kawep: bky6_6NQiA4

TICKET-4417: PedalShift vault locked. New folks: PedalShift is our bike-share rebalancing tool; its config vault auto-locks after three bad unlock attempts. This happened overnight, so the truck-routing job can't read depot weights. Don't retry the unlock — you'll extend the lockout. Escalate only if rebalancing stalls past 0900. To restore access, use the recovery passphrase below.

unlock words, kajeg-fahif: holmir-casael-novdor